How AI is Changing SEO and Web Design: What Developers Need to Know

AI has not replaced SEO or web design — it has changed what good looks like. Search results now summarise answers before a user ever clicks, and the sites that still win traffic are the ones that give a machine something worth quoting.

Search results answer before they link

AI overviews and chat-style answers sit above the traditional results, which means a page that only restates common knowledge gets summarised and skipped. The click now goes to sources with something specific — original data, direct experience, real pricing, real process.

Structure is now a ranking input, not a nicety

Models parse pages the same way crawlers do, only less forgivingly. Clean heading hierarchies, semantic HTML, descriptive alt text and structured data are what make your content extractable.

  • One H1 per page, headings in logical order
  • Schema markup for organisation, articles, products and FAQs
  • Alt text that describes content, not keywords
  • Fast, server-rendered HTML rather than content that only appears after JavaScript runs

Where AI genuinely helps developers

Use it for the work that scales badly: drafting meta descriptions across hundreds of pages, generating alt text candidates, spotting broken internal links, clustering keywords, writing test cases. Keep it away from anything that requires judgement about your client’s business.

The failure pattern we see most often is publishing AI-generated copy unedited. It reads plausibly, ranks briefly, then decays — because it says nothing a hundred other pages have not already said.

What to do this quarter

Audit your top ten pages for extractability. Can a model read your page and correctly state what you do, where you do it and what it costs? If not, that is the fix — before any new content, before any redesign.

AI rewards specificity and structure. Publish what only you can publish, mark it up properly, and let the tools handle the repetitive work.
